    Every single one of those pairs has something important in common. They are all FBS. That means a 12 game schedule every single year. NDSU plays in the FCS, which means an 11 game schedule about seven years out of ten. Because of that difference, NDSU can have an annual FBS game, six home games, or an annual game with UND; pick two of the three. For many of us, six home games plus the annual FBS game is more important than an NDSU/UND game. If FCS had 12 game schedules every year, then NDSU could have all three choices. But that's not the world we live in.
